I am 52, and I LOVE my Salt & Pepper hair. I modeled for a hair show last year and they used a "semi-permanent" color. My lovely ash/dark S&P is still brownish in areas, so long afterward. Also my hair is resistant to stripping the natural color, so when I ADDED gray streaks to brighten my face, it turned yellow, and looked like I was trying to add blonde, which was not a good look for me. Yellow tones make me sallow!

I SO wish the color industry would wake up and realize there is big money in helping women my age TRANSITION to the natural gray state, rather than hide it!!!I think the gray hair on a fit older woman is very sexy, and I have found so much work as a model BECAUSE I am gray and I am NOT trying to hide the fact. I think my face looks younger with the Salt & Pepper, and older with "perfect, young" hair.

Wake up, hair industry!!!

Give us a way to BRIGHTEN the gray and add a bit MORE that looks natural, not yellow.

Re: grey hair
by: Professiona stylists

Well number one grey hair has no pigment in it so if you just put a grey dye on your hair it would not turn it grey.......... So I would honestly recommend you finding someone to to WEAVE bleach through your whole head and have them bleach your hair to a pail white color then after the wash the bleach out of your hair before they wash it have them put a toner from Shades EQ and I would recommend using 09B ( sterling ) and let it sit on your hair for a min or so but just have your stylists watch it and make sure she don't rinse it too soon........ This should help you out so that you can let your natural grey grow but at will help you get the look you want for the time being
